The Controller’s Office provides a system for financial reporting and accountability of all Western Nevada College and college-related funds and is responsible for collection, disbursement and custody of these funds. The Controller’s Office provides a number of services including the following:
- Fee Assessment and collection
- Financial Aid Disbursements (including scholarships, loans, grants)
- Collections
- Sponsored/Third Party Billing

How to make a payment?
- The preferred and quickest method is to make your payment using a debit card, credit card or e-check by logging in to MyWNC.
- Payments may also be made by check or money order, made payable to “Board of Regents” and mailed to:
- Western Nevada College
Controller’s Office
2201 W. College Parkway
Carson City, NV 89703

How do I sign up for Direct Deposit?
The Controller’s Office now offers direct deposit as a more convenient means of providing refunds to students. The advantages of direct deposits are:
- Convenience – no waiting on mail to receive checks or deposit checks.
- Quick Access – the funds are available within two business days after the transactions have been processed in the Student Accounts.
- Safety – prevents loss or theft of check.
Signing up is easy. Go to MyWNC and in your Student Center, select the “Enroll in Direct Deposit” link.
